Originally Posted by Bocajnala
I don't like splitting them all the way open. Where I hunt in mostly thick stuff, that results in the chest cavity being filled with junk.

Anymore I often don't even remove the lungs or heart if I'm dragging them out and skinning right away. I cut the diaphragm and pull the guts out all the way to the butt hole. And leave the heart and lungs in there.

Works for me as I like to save the heart . Just one less thing to worry about in the woods.
